Noia Comments on Industry Task Force Report

(St. John’s, NL – April 30, 2021) Yesterday, the Government of Newfoundland and Labrador released the Oil and Gas Industry Recovery Task Force Report which contains 52 recommendations pertaining to the Newfoundland and Labrador offshore oil and gas industry. Remembering Flight 491

(St. John’s, NL – March 12, 2021) Twelve years ago today, our province experienced the tragic loss of 17 people when Flight 491 crashed in the waters off Newfoundland and Labrador.
